Plaque on wall at Pushkarski street. It indicates that this area was called Pushkarski because it was the suburb in which the streltsi and pushkari lived (that is the special infantry and artillerymen) but was renamed during Soviet times and has now, in 1994, been returned to the original name. This is typical of many streets and regions in Moscow. In fact one now needs a glossary to relate the Soviet and historical (and now returned) names.
